Damages
Accidents with trucks can cause a variety of damages, such as financial losses and emotional stress. These damages include medical expenses as well as lost wages and property damage, among other things.
The most commonly used kind of compensation after the crash of a truck is economic damages. These are monetary awards paid to the victims. This type of compensation can be used to cover medical costs, rehabilitation and lost wages.
You may also be able to collect a significant amount of non-economic damages in the event that the accident is serious enough. These damages are meant to provide you with compensation for the physical as well as mental suffering.
Punitive damages are a different form of compensation that can be given. They are not intended to compensate you for your losses, but to punish the party who is responsible for their actions. They are usually awarded when the at-fault party deliberately engaged in unintentionally or maliciously acted that caused harm to others.
To be able to claim these damages, you need to prove that the at-fault party's negligent or wrongdoing resulted in injuries like medical bills and lost income. This requires careful documentation and an experienced lawyer to ensure that you receive the full amount for all losses.
You can also claim damages for lost earnings if your accident rendered you incapable of work. These damages are especially beneficial in cases where the injuries you sustained were so severe that you'll have difficulty generating a regular income in the future.

Expert Witnesses
Expert witnesses play an important role in cases involving top truck accident lawyers accidents and provide the jury with evidence that is difficult for ordinary jurors to comprehend. Expert witnesses are usually familiar with complex mechanical and physical concepts and economic and medical details. They also have specialist understanding of regulations for trucking.
In addition they are skilled in giving evidence that can help the jury to understand your case in a concise and meaningful manner. They are crucial in proving the guilt and damages resulting from truck crash lawyer accidents.
They can also provide information into the reason why the accident took place, as well as the severity of any injuries. Experts can assist in determining the amount of compensation that the victim is entitled to.
Depending on the nature of accident depending on the type of accident, trucking accident lawyers can use different types of experts to support their clients' claims. For example lawyers representing victims of truck accidents may call a truck crash reconstruction expert to testify as to what caused the crash and who was responsible.
Experts can also employ timelines and visual aids to explain the events of the crash more clearly. They can also show pictures and videos to assist jurors or judges be able to comprehend.
An attorney who handles a trucking accident may also choose an economic expert who will testify as to how the loss of income and the ongoing medical bills have affected their lives. The expert can use various formulas to show the full extent of financial losses a victim has suffered due to an accident with a truck.
